On Rakshabandhan, sisters and brothers courier gifts for brothers who are away from home, but sometimes due to postal delay, these loving gifts do not reach on time. If this has happened to you too and the Rakhi sent through speed post or registry has not been delivered on time, then now you can lodge a complaint about it and also get a refund as per the rules.

Indian Postal Department has simplified the tracking and complaint system to improve its services. You can check the status of your parcel online with the help of the 13 digit consignment number present on the receipt received while sending Rakhi.

For this, go to the official website of Indian Post and enter the consignment number in the Track N Trace option. With this you will know at which post office or hub your parcel last reached. If there is no update in tracking or there is a long delay in delivery, you can use the complaint service of the postal department. For this, you will have to go to the India Post website and select Register Complaint option in the Complaints section. Here you will have to fill important information like sender and recipient information, booking date and mobile number.

After registering the complaint, you will get a reference number, with the help of which you can also check the status of your complaint. As per the rules of the Postal Department, there is a provision to refund the postage charges in some cases if the service is not completed within the stipulated time. So this Rakshabandhan, if your Rakhi or gift has not arrived on time, instead of getting upset, start tracking, lodge a complaint and exercise your rights.
